Explain different ways you can arrange 4 resistors in order to get different equivalent resistance values. Mention about minimum and maximum values you can obtain.

Solutions

Expert Solution

​​​​​for maximum equivalent resistance all resistors are should be in series =4R

For minimum equivalent resistance all resistors should be in parallel = R/4
